Why Flat Vector Illustrations Work Better Than Photos

You might wonder why a vector illustration is preferred over a high-resolution photograph. The answer lies in versatility and brand consistency. Photographs can feel staged or generic, and they often clash with diverse color schemes. A flat vector illustration, such as the one depicting a teacher and students with tea, can be easily customized.

Designers can adjust the colors to match your brand identity seamlessly. If your brand uses calming blues and greens, the illustration can be tweaked to reflect that palette. This level of customization ensures that the Sign Up Page with Students in Class. Tea asset feels like an integral part of your website, not an afterthought. Furthermore, vector files are lightweight, ensuring that your page load speeds remain fast—a critical factor for SEO and user retention.

Integrating the Illustration into Your Design Workflow

To get the most out of this resource, integrate it thoughtfully into your web design. Do not just drop it into a corner. Use it to guide the eye. For example, position the teacher’s gaze or the laptop screen toward your sign-up form. This creates a natural visual flow that leads the user directly to the conversion point.

Pair the illustration with concise, benefit-driven copy. Instead of just saying "Sign Up," try "Join Our Community of Learners." The image provides the emotional context, while the text provides the logical reason to act. Together, they create a compelling narrative that encourages immediate action.
